Output 6318cc4b66da11ae47f233cb37b097482ee644d1389c1ebf0b08cfbaa8ef0a4c:1

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beb3d52490a8fe43098a364df2e6dbe967133be OP_EQUAL
address
3LHEuDR9Fr63vkP1QPeSFGJFgsNodpzwB1
transaction
6318cc4b66da11ae47f233cb37b097482ee644d1389c1ebf0b08cfbaa8ef0a4c
confirmations
282848
spent
true